SIDNEY — Any teacher who works in Shelby County can get a big break on paying for supplies for their classrooms next week.

Agape Distribution, 209 S. Brooklyn Ave., will give a voucher worth $25 to any teacher who goes there from Aug. 3 to Aug. 8. The vouchers are good for purchasing supplies at Agape Distribution.

“Twenty-five dollars is like $100-$125 retail,” said director Dr. John Geissler. “They can spend as much as they want, but the first $25 is on us.”

Most of the items are priced at 25 percent of retail, he added. “It will maximize dollars.”

Office supplies, colored paper, copier paper, party supplies for decorating classrooms, personal items including hand sanitizers and paper towels, white boards, snacks and other items are available.

“We’re supporters of education,” Geissler said. “And educators are education. We want to help them do what they do best: build young lives.”

Agape Distribution has offered discounted and free supplies to teachers in the past, but has never before made them available for a whole week.

To get the discounts, teachers must present their teacher ID cards. The hours when Agape is open for shopping are Monday through Thursday, from 8 a.m. to 5 p.m., and Saturday, from 8 a.m. to noon. The organization is closed on Friday.
